隨著科技的發展和計算機的普及,越來越多的業務和活動需要電子化處理,而在這個過程中,投標文件的加密和解密是必不可少的。
投標文件是指投標人向招標人提交的有關項目或服務的文件,包括技術標、商務標、資格證明文件等。這些文件通常包含了投標人的機密信息和商業秘密,因此需要采取加密措施來保護這些信息,避免被泄露或被競爭對手獲取。
加密和解密是投標文件中加密保護和保密傳輸的重要手段。下面將介紹投標文件加密和解密的基本步驟和注意事項。
一、加密步驟
1.選擇加密方式
目前常用的加密方式有對稱加密和非對稱加密兩種。對稱加密是指加密和解密使用同一密鑰,速度快,但安全性相對較低。非對稱加密是指使用公鑰和私鑰來進行加密和解密,安全性較高,但速度較慢。
2.選擇加密算法
常用的加密算法有AES、DES、RSA等。其中,AES算法最強大,安全性較高,但需要更多的計算資源和時間。DES算法較舊,安全性較低,但速度較快。RSA算法是非對稱加密中常用的一種算法,安全性較高,但需要更多的計算資源和時間。
3.生成密鑰
根據所選的加密方式和算法,生成一組隨機數作為密鑰。密鑰長度應該足夠長,以提高安全性。一般來說,密鑰長度應該在128位以上。
4.加密文件
將需要加密的文件用生成的密鑰進行加密。具體操作方法和流程根據所選的加密方式和算法而定。
二、解密步驟
1.獲取密鑰
要解密加密的文件,必須先獲取正確的密鑰。如果密鑰丟失或被泄露,則無法解密文件。因此,在加密文件時,應該妥善保管好密鑰,最好備份一份。
2.選擇解密算法和程序
解密算法和程序應該與加密方式和算法相匹配。如果加密時使用的是AES算法,那么解密時也應該使用AES算法。如果使用的是非對稱加密算法,那么解密時應該使用與加密對應的解密算法和程序。
3.解密文件
將需要解密的文件用獲取到的密鑰進行解密。具體操作方法和流程根據所選的解密算法和程序而定。
三、注意事項
1.在加密和解密過程中,一定要保證密鑰的安全性和機密性,避免被競爭對手或惡意攻擊者獲取。
2.在加密和解密過程中,要考慮到防火墻、入侵檢測系統等網絡安全設備的檢測和阻斷能力,避免機密信息在網絡傳輸過程中被截獲或被攻擊。
3.在加密和解密過程中,要注意文件的格式和類型,避免加密后的文件不可用或無法打開。
4.在加密和解密過程中,要注意操作方法和流程的正確性,避免因為操作不當而導致文件損壞或信息泄露。
5.在加密和解密過程中,要定期更換密鑰和算法,提高系統的安全性和可靠性。
總之,投標文件的加密和解密是保護投標人商業秘密和信息安全的重要手段。投標人應該重視這項工作,采取適當的措施和方法來保證文件的安全性和機密性。